The FUJI HGC-250Ⅱ High Frequency Angle Grinder represents a paradigm shift in industrial grinding efficiency. Engineered for durability and operational agility, this 4-inch (100mm) powerhouse is designed to meet the rigorous demands of modern foundries, shipyards, and heavy metal fabrication.
Unlike standard electric tools that slow down under pressure, the HGC-250Ⅱ utilizes 250Hz High-Frequency Technology to maintain constant rotational speed, ensuring rapid material removal and consistent finish quality.
Key Technical Advantages
⚡ No Speed Drop (Constant RPM) Powered by a three-phase squirrel cage induction motor, the HGC-250Ⅱ maintains peripheral wheel speeds of 8700RPM/min. It is engineered for less than 0.5% speed variance under full load, boosting productivity by over 20%.
🛡️ Durability & Low Maintenance With no commutator or carbon brushes to replace, the induction motor design extends maintenance intervals by 40% compared to standard DC motor tools. It is built to withstand dust and continuous heavy-duty operation.
📏 Compact Powerhouse Weighing only 2.0kg, it is approximately 30% lighter than comparable industrial grinders. The compact design (272mm length) ensures operator comfort during prolonged use without compromising structural integrity.
⚙️ Advanced Safety Compliant with JIS strict standards, featuring an ergonomic body design and optional safety guards. The robust construction minimizes vibration, reducing the risk of White Finger Syndrome (HAVS).

⚠️ System Requirement: Power Supply This tool requires a High Frequency Generator (Frequency Converter) to operate. It cannot be plugged into standard 50/60Hz wall outlets. Recommended Power Supply: FG-505NE / FG-605NE High Frequency Generator.
Ideal Industrial Applications
The HGC-250Ⅱ is the preferred choice for sectors requiring rapid metal removal and 24/7 reliability:
Foundry & Casting Rapid removal of gates, risers, and parting lines on iron and steel castings.
Metal Fabrication Smoothing heavy weld seams and beveling plate edges for preparation.

FUJI Industrial Quality & Safety Protocols
Fuji products are manufactured following strict Japanese standard process requirements. Every wheel is engineered to meet or exceed JIS (Japanese Industrial Standards), such as JIS R 6242 and B 4051. Our core engineering logic prioritizes maximum operator protection by maintaining safety factors and burst speed capabilities that often surpass the highest industry benchmarks.
Standard Region
Safety Factor (Burst Multiplier)
Safety Logic & Benchmark
FUJI (High Precision)
> 2.0x
Engineered to exceed JIS requirements for maximum reliability.
Japan (JIS R 6242)
2.0x
Extreme Safety: A wheel rated at 80m/s must withstand a 160m/s burst test.
Europe (EN 12413)
$1.73x
Risk Balanced: Provides high safety redundancy for most industrial apps.
USA (ANSI B7.1)
1.5x
Efficiency Focused: Relies on machine guarding and operational procedures.
1.RPM Compliance: Never exceed the maximum R.P.M. specified on the wheel. Using the sides of the wheels for grinding is strictly prohibited, as it compromises the structural integrity of the abrasive bond.
2.Mandatory Idling: Allow the tool to idle for one minute before beginning work. If a new wheel has been mounted, an idle run of three minutes is required to ensure dynamic stability.
3.Workpiece Stability: All materials must be securely fastened. Improperly secured workpieces can lead to vibration, wheel binding, and unsafe kickback forces.
4.Arbor Hole Integrity: Do not modify or enlarge the metal center of the arbor hole. A proper fit is critical; a mismatched arbor causes eccentric rotation and dangerous vibration levels.
5.PPE Requirements: Industrial-grade face and eye protection are mandatory at all times. Ensure all protective gear meets local safety compliance standards.
6.Guard Protection: Protection guards are designed to contain fragments in the unlikely event of a wheel failure. Never operate tools or machinery with guards removed.

When deploying Fuji high-performance tools in overseas markets, ensure that the regional power grid frequency and voltage match the tool specifications. To maintain the superior burst speed safety of Fuji wheels, store abrasives in a dry, temperate environment. Humidity can degrade the resin bond, potentially lowering the wheel’s resistance to centrifugal forces.
